## Runbook: GC Pauses in PairLine Matcher

When the PairLine matching service exceeds its 250ms pause budget, the Venlow orchestrator marks the node degraded and reroutes order flow. Before tuning heap flags, confirm the pause telemetry agent is authenticated, since unauthenticated agents silently drop GC samples and mask the regression. The agent reads its credentials from the service env file at /etc/pairline/env, which the security team audits quarterly. The env file's first effective line sets the telemetry agent's credential as follows.

sealed setting: ARCHIVE_KEY3=8d0

Welcome aboard! Quick note on the parcel-tracking webhook: whenever Cartonbird's sorting hub scans a package, we POST a status event to your endpoint within a few seconds. You'll want to test against the sandbox first — it replays fake scan events every minute. To authenticate your sandbox calls, use the key below.

API key for yahig-tadup: kto7_ubizbYm

Ticket LV-88: Vault locked on the Liftwise simulator box. Hey — the scenario vault on the dispatch simulator locked itself again after the weekend patch run, and nobody can load the tower test fixtures. Since you're new: don't try brute-forcing the unlock tool, it extends the lockout. Just run the recovery prompt from the sim console and enter the passphrase shown below.

strongbox words: sorir-belvan-rusix-ulays-ralmir-praix-eliir-tamax-praael-druael-julir-tamius-jorir

**Release checklist — ScanBridge integration.** Before sign-off, verify the Varnholt barcode scanner pairs correctly in both wedge and serial modes, and confirm that malformed UPC reads trigger the graceful-retry prompt rather than a silent drop. Support should reproduce the pairing flow on at least two test units. The verified build reference appears below.

build token for tawip-yageg: htk9_92ac43d42